As nouns the difference between halogen and chloroalkane

is that halogen is (chemistry) any element of group 7, ie fluorine, chlorine, bromine, iodine and astatine, which form a salt by direct union with a metal while chloroalkane is (organic chemistry) any haloalkane in which the halogen is chlorine.
